Why Construction Estimating Company Adds Value

Beyond individual tools, a construction estimating company provides comprehensive support for contractors. These companies specialize in producing complete cost estimates that include not only lumber but also labor, equipment, and overhead. Their expertise ensures every detail of a project is accounted for before work begins.

Outsourcing to a construction estimating company allows contractors to save valuable time. Instead of spending hours analyzing drawings and pricing materials, they can rely on professionals who combine industry experience with advanced estimating technology. This partnership helps builders focus on execution while maintaining control of project finances.

How a Construction Estimating Company Improves Bid Competitiveness

Winning projects in today’s market often come down to who can deliver the most accurate and competitive bid. A construction estimating service strengthens this process by preparing detailed estimates that reflect true costs. Contractors are then able to submit realistic bids, avoiding the risks of underpricing or overpricing.

Additionally, a construction estimating company can identify potential issues in project designs or specifications before construction begins. By flagging risks early, they help contractors avoid costly overruns and delays. This proactive approach not only saves money but also builds trust with clients, leading to repeat business and referrals
